Project-Based Learning: Igniting Passion and Empowering Students

In traditional education, students often find themselves sitting in rows of desks, passively absorbing information from textbooks and lectures. While this method has its merits, it may not always engage students or prepare them for the complex challenges they will face in the real world. This is where project-based learning (PBL) comes into play.

Project-based learning is an educational approach that focuses on providing students with hands-on experiences to solve real-world problems or complete meaningful projects. Rather than being passive recipients of knowledge, students become active participants in their own learning process. By working collaboratively, researching, planning, and creating solutions to authentic problems, students gain a deeper understanding of the subject matter while simultaneously developing critical thinking skills and fostering creativity.

One key aspect of project-based learning is its ability to ignite passion within students. Traditional classroom setups can sometimes stifle individual interests and unique talents as everyone is expected to conform to a standardized curriculum. However, PBL allows learners to explore topics that truly interest them while connecting those subjects with real-world applications.

By giving students the freedom to choose their projects based on personal interests or concerns within their communities, educators can tap into intrinsic motivation. When individuals are genuinely passionate about what they are studying or working on, they become more engaged and willing to invest time and effort into achieving desired outcomes. As a result, project-based learning encourages self-directed learners who take ownership of their education rather than relying solely on external rewards such as grades.

Moreover, PBL enables interdisciplinary connections that bridge disparate subjects together seamlessly. In traditional classrooms where subjects are taught separately without much integration between them, it can be challenging for learners to understand how these subjects relate in practical terms outside of academia. Project-based learning erases these boundaries by presenting opportunities for cross-disciplinary exploration.

For example, a project centered around sustainable agriculture might involve elements from biology (studying plant growth), chemistry (analyzing soil composition), mathematics (calculating crop yields and expenses), and even art or design (creating visual representations of the final product). By connecting different subjects in a meaningful context, project-based learning not only enhances students’ understanding but also equips them with valuable skills that they can apply throughout their lives.

Another strength of project-based learning lies in its emphasis on collaboration. In today’s interconnected world, the ability to work effectively as part of a team is highly valued by employers. PBL offers students countless opportunities to develop these essential collaborative skills through group projects, presentations, and discussions.

In addition to fostering teamwork, project-based learning nurtures problem-solving abilities. Rather than simply memorizing facts or regurgitating information, students are challenged to think critically and find innovative solutions to real-world problems. This process encourages learners to ask questions, analyze data, evaluate options, and make informed decisions – all valuable skills that will serve them well beyond the classroom.

However, implementing project-based learning successfully requires careful planning and consideration from educators. For starters, it is crucial to provide clear guidelines and expectations for each project while allowing enough flexibility for creativity and exploration. Teachers should act as facilitators rather than dictators of knowledge – guiding students when needed but ultimately empowering them to take charge of their own learning journey.

Furthermore, assessment methods in PBL differ from traditional testing formats; therefore teachers need to adapt their evaluation strategies accordingly. Instead of relying solely on exams or quizzes that test rote memorization, assessment in PBL should focus on multiple dimensions such as creativity, critical thinking skills demonstrated during the project development process itself—through artifacts like portfolios or presentations—and self-reflection exercises where students evaluate their own growth throughout the project.

It is worth noting that while project-based learning has numerous advantages over traditional education approaches; it may not be suitable for every subject matter or every student population. Some topics require foundational knowledge before engaging in project-based work. Additionally, certain students may struggle with the autonomy and self-direction required in PBL settings.

To address these challenges, educators can incorporate a blended approach that combines project-based learning with more traditional instructional methods. This hybrid model ensures that students receive both the foundational knowledge necessary for deeper exploration and exposure to different learning styles.

In conclusion, project-based learning is a powerful educational tool that empowers students by igniting passion, nurturing critical thinking skills, fostering creativity, and promoting collaboration. By providing authentic opportunities to apply knowledge to real-world problems or projects of personal interest, learners become active participants in their education rather than passive recipients of information. Although careful planning and adaptation are necessary for successful implementation, the benefits of project-based learning make it an invaluable addition to any alternative schooling or educational program.
